Compare the rivalry schools - University of Toledo and Central Michigan University.

University of Toledo is a Public, 4-years school located in Toledo, OH and Central Michigan University is a Public, 4-years school located in Mount Pleasant, MI. Following list and table compares two rivalry schools in various academic factors.
  • University of Toledo has higher submitted SAT score (1,150) than Central Michigan University (1,090).
  • Central Michigan University (78.95% acceptance rate) is tighter than University of Toledo (92.23% acceptance rate) to get in.
  • University of Toledo (15,545 students) is larger than Central Michigan University (14,557 students).
  • University of Toledo has more expensive tuition & fees of $21,737 than Central Michigan University($14,190).
  • University of Toledo has more full-time faculties of 724 faculties than Central Michigan University(717 facluties).
